ALEXANDRIA, Va., June 5 -- United States Patent no. 12,278,467, issued on April 15, was assigned to Schneider Electric USA Inc. (Boston).
"Scalable power tap off system" was invented by James Raymond Ramsey (Murfreesboro, Tenn.), Timothy O'Leary (Antioch, Tenn.) and Clay Miller Cecil (Nashville, Tenn.).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"A scalable power tap off system is provided for a power distribution system.
